The Official Release Date Finally Confirmed
After months of speculation and rumors, HBO has officially confirmed that House of the Dragon Season 3 will premiere in June 2026. This announcement came through multiple channels, including an updated breakdown published just three days ago that states both Season 3 and the HBO spin-off A Knight of the Seven Kingdoms will release only after extensive production delays. The return of House of the Dragon is locked for June 2026, giving fans nearly a year and a half to prepare for the next chapter in the Targaryen civil war.

Production Timeline and Behind-the-Scenes Drama
Production for House of the Dragon Season 3 commenced in March 2025 and has been described as hectic by members of the cast and crew. The filming schedule ran from March to October 2025, a timeline that initially seemed standard for a production of this scale. However, sources close to the production have revealed that the season was plagued by numerous challenges, from weather disruptions to creative disagreements between showrunners and HBO executives. The hectic production schedule has reportedly taken a toll on the cast, with several actors speaking out about the intense pressure to deliver groundbreaking visual effects and battle sequences.
The upcoming season will serve as the penultimate chapter of the Game of Thrones prequel saga, with HBO confirming that House of the Dragon will conclude with its fourth and final season. This knowledge has added additional pressure on the creative team to deliver a season that not only advances the story but also sets up the epic conclusion that fans are expecting.
